A minor detained following the death of a neighbour in Zarandona
National Police officers have arrested a youth who has just reached the age of majority, of Ukrainian nationality, in connection with the death of David, a 40-year-old resident of the Murcian district of Zarandona. The arrest took place on Wednesday morning, according to La Opinión de Murcia.
The deceased was found in a park in the municipality with serious injuries and barely conscious. Medical services transported him to a hospital, where he died hours later. The news has shocked residents of this area of Murcia, where the man was affectionately known as "El Duque".
Sources close to the case indicate that the investigation is being classified as homicide, not murder. The legal difference lies in the absence of aggravating circumstances such as treachery, cruelty, or economic motivation. When death results from a fight, as appears to be the case here, it is understood that there was no prior intent to kill.
The arrested individual is being held at Ceballos Police Station and will be brought before the Duty Court in Murcia no later than Saturday. He is facing a charge of reckless homicide, although the investigation remains active and further arrests may be made.
The Homicide Group is leading the inquiry. Authorities have urged the public not to spread speculation—some allegations pointed to the involvement of unaccompanied foreign youths—and to place their trust in law enforcement.
Neighbours and family members bade farewell to David on the preceding Tuesday with a Eucharist in the parish church and a subsequent gathering at which flowers and candles were offered in his memory.
